目录

github存储代码上传更新删除-实操版

github存储代码(上传更新删除)–实操版

一、创建存储库

1、在github中创建一个仓库,不想公开可以私有化

https://i-blog.csdnimg.cn/direct/e340caf51f2a472db5179a691915ccbb.png

https://i-blog.csdnimg.cn/direct/06e9f749234447c69ba95e337c5ecd2a.png

2、创建完成后可以看自己的仓库地址和一些命令

https://i-blog.csdnimg.cn/direct/84ef3a2910324d6da45d063e2554dc63.png

二、git代码上传工具下载

1、windows版下载链接

      下载就可以安装使用了

https://i-blog.csdnimg.cn/direct/e41c0416309f497089a21b74be20a028.png

三、GitBash

1、待上传文件夹

https://i-blog.csdnimg.cn/direct/04066c7c9af84261bf364a2fb6ae5af5.png

2、使用GitBash

https://i-blog.csdnimg.cn/direct/f70c1da406054469bee3cbcb6d5ecb35.png

四、上传、更新、删除代码到github
1、初次上传代码

git init                                                          #会生成一个.git文件     https://i-blog.csdnimg.cn/direct/6c982ab93a374cfab1d2547c8b87ec63.png

git branch -a                                               #检查当前分支状态

git checkout -b main                                   #创建并切换到main分支

git branch -D master                                  #删除本地master分支(master有点西方政治问题,

                                                                     因此大多使用main)

git add .                                                      #将文件添加到缓冲区

git commit -m “初始提交”                           #提交添加到缓冲区

git remote add origin xxx@xxx/test.git       #与github仓库建立连接

git push origin main                                    #提交代码

https://i-blog.csdnimg.cn/direct/5ce403354b6d470bbb5c6fdabe612f5b.png

提交后就可以看到代码了

https://i-blog.csdnimg.cn/direct/9cbe13cfead34f15bb807ea85f6b168c.png

2、更新新文件

https://i-blog.csdnimg.cn/direct/d3dd5bb3bf53414d848c9a88d6588545.png

git add 更新.txt
git commit -m “更新”

git push -u origin main

https://i-blog.csdnimg.cn/direct/2d60e319404f4f8b934662893002cf84.png

更新完成

https://i-blog.csdnimg.cn/direct/129fff7e078b4ced83b547f6e740dfef.png

3、删除文件

git rm -f ‘更新.txt’
git commit -m ‘del’
git push -u origin main

https://i-blog.csdnimg.cn/direct/197a431494854b71a0adcc3f8f5169e2.png

删除完毕

https://i-blog.csdnimg.cn/direct/6d49e4db326744f4bf9809c98f078c2a.png


如果有错误感谢批评指正(^▽^)